Where is the Paulauskis family from?

You can see how Paulauskis families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Paulauskis family name was found in the USA in 1920. In 1920 there were 4 Paulauskis families living in Illinois. This was about 57% of all the recorded Paulauskis's in USA. Illinois had the highest population of Paulauskis families in 1920.

What did your Paulauskis ancestors do for a living?

In 1940, Common Laborer was the top reported job for people in the USA named Paulauskis. 43% of Paulauskis men worked as a Common Laborer.
